If you’ve been searching for a dish that feels both sophisticated and comforting, I have just the thing: the Easy Tomato Spinach Feta Quiche Recipe. Imagine a buttery, flaky puff pastry crust hugging a luscious filling of fresh spinach, tangy feta, and sweet cherry tomatoes, all brought together with creamy eggs and a hint of oregano. This quiche is perfect for brunch, lunch, or even a light dinner, and it’s surprisingly simple to make despite its elegant appearance. Trust me, once you try this recipe, it’ll quickly become one of your favorite go-to dishes to impress friends or enjoy a cozy meal at home.

Ingredients You’ll Need
Every ingredient in the Easy Tomato Spinach Feta Quiche Recipe plays an important role in creating that perfect balance of flavors and textures. From the creamy eggs to the vibrant spinach and juicy tomatoes, each element is thoughtfully selected to make this quiche shine.
- 8.5 oz puff pastry: This forms the flaky, buttery crust that holds everything together—avoid shortcuts here for best texture.
- 5 large eggs: The rich base binding the filling, providing structure and creaminess.
- 2/3 cup heavy cream: Adds a luscious, velvety texture to the filling, making every bite silky smooth.
- 1/2 cup milk: Lightens the custard so it’s not too dense, balancing creaminess with a tender consistency.
- 2 cups baby spinach: Fresh and vibrant, spinach gives a lovely pop of green and earthy flavor—chop if leaves are large.
- 1/4 cup grated parmesan: Boosts savory notes with its nutty, sharp richness.
- 1 teaspoon dried oregano: Infuses the quiche with warm herbal aroma, complementing the feta beautifully.
- 1/2 teaspoon salt: Enhances all the natural flavors, especially the cheese and spinach.
- Black pepper to taste: Adds a subtle spice that wakes up the palate without overpowering.
- 6 oz feta cheese, coarsely crumbled: Creamy and tangy, feta is the star cheese here, offering delightful bursts of flavor.
- 1/2 pound cherry tomatoes: Juicy and sweet, they provide bright color and fresh contrast to the creamy filling.
- 1 teaspoon olive oil: Used to brush the tomatoes before baking, bringing out their natural sweetness.
How to Make Easy Tomato Spinach Feta Quiche Recipe
Step 1: Blind Bake the Puff Pastry
First things first, preheat your oven to 400°F (200°C). Lightly grease your 9-inch deep-dish pie plate and gently fit the rolled-out puff pastry into it, letting the edges hang over. Prick the base multiple times with a fork—that’s the secret trick to keep the crust from puffing up too much. Next, cover the pastry with baking parchment and fill it with pie weights or dried beans. This helps the crust stay flat and crisp. Blind bake it for 15 minutes, remove the weights, and bake for an additional 10 minutes. Don’t worry if the middle puffs up a bit; it will settle once out of the oven.
Step 2: Prepare the Filling
While your crust is baking, whisk together the eggs, heavy cream, and milk in a large bowl until well combined. Stir in the baby spinach, grated parmesan, oregano, salt, and black pepper. This mixture is the luscious custard that brings everything to life. The spinach adds freshness, parmesan sharpness, and oregano a layer of herbal warmth that perfectly complements the feta.
Step 3: Assemble Your Quiche
Once the pastry has cooled slightly, lower the oven temperature to 360°F (180°C). Scatter the crumbled feta evenly across the bottom of the pastry shell—this ensures every bite has that delightful, tangy cheese flavor. Pour your spinach and egg filling over the feta, and then brush the cherry tomatoes with olive oil to bring out their sweetness. Nestle the tomatoes in a single layer on top of the filling for a beautiful presentation and bursts of juicy flavor.
Step 4: Bake the Quiche
Bake your quiche for 20 minutes. To prevent the pastry rim from overbrowning, cover it carefully with a pie shield or tin foil. Continue baking for another 30 to 35 minutes, or until the filling is set and just slightly golden on top. This slow baking ensures a perfectly cooked custard that’s firm but still creamy in the middle.
Step 5: Rest and Serve
Allow your quiche to rest for about 10 minutes before slicing. This resting time helps the filling settle, making clean cuts much easier and preventing any wobbling. You can serve it warm, at room temperature, or even chilled—each variation bringing out different aspects of its flavor.
How to Serve Easy Tomato Spinach Feta Quiche Recipe

Garnishes
A sprinkle of freshly chopped basil or parsley adds a pop of color and a fresh herbal note that brightens each slice. For a touch of elegance, drizzle a little extra virgin olive oil or balsamic glaze just before serving. If you love a bit of heat, crushed red pepper flakes on top work wonders too.
Side Dishes
This quiche pairs beautifully with a crisp green salad dressed in a light lemon vinaigrette—think arugula or mixed baby greens. For a heartier meal, roasted new potatoes seasoned with rosemary, or a simple bowl of soup like tomato bisque makes an inviting combo. The freshness of the sides balances the richness of the quiche perfectly.
Creative Ways to Present
Consider serving mini versions of this quiche in muffin tins for a charming brunch option that guests can grab and go. For a colorful twist, layer different colored cherry tomatoes or add roasted red peppers to the filling. You can even make a savory tart by rolling the puff pastry thinner and cutting it into squares for easy appetizers.
Make Ahead and Storage
Storing Leftovers
Once cooled completely, cover the quiche tightly with plastic wrap or store in an airtight container. It keeps well in the refrigerator for up to 24 hours, making it a fantastic option for next-day meals or quick lunches.
Freezing
If you want to prepare ahead, this quiche freezes beautifully. Wrap tightly in plastic wrap and foil before freezing to guard against freezer burn. When ready to enjoy, thaw overnight in the fridge.
Reheating
Reheat slices in a preheated oven at 350°F (175°C) for about 10-15 minutes to regain that fresh-baked texture and warm filling. Avoid the microwave if possible, as it can make the crust soggy. Reheating gently helps the flavours and crunchiness come back to life.
FAQs
Can I use fresh herbs instead of dried oregano?
Absolutely! Fresh oregano or even thyme can be great substitutes and bring a bright, herbaceous flavor. Just use about a tablespoon of fresh herbs instead of a teaspoon of dried.
What can I substitute for puff pastry?
If puff pastry isn’t available, a good-quality pie crust or shortcrust pastry will work well. However, puff pastry gives that signature flakiness and buttery lift that makes this quiche so special.
Can I make this quiche vegetarian?
This recipe is naturally vegetarian as it contains no meat. Just double-check that your puff pastry doesn’t contain any animal-derived ingredients if you follow a strict vegetarian diet.
Can I add other vegetables to this quiche?
Yes! Feel free to experiment by adding sautéed mushrooms, bell peppers, or caramelized onions. Just be mindful of moisture—pat veggies dry to avoid a soggy crust.
How do I know when the quiche is fully cooked?
The filling should be set and slightly puffed, not jiggle when you gently shake the dish. The edges might be golden brown, and a toothpick inserted in the center should come out mostly clean.
Final Thoughts
You really can’t go wrong with the Easy Tomato Spinach Feta Quiche Recipe. It’s a crowd-pleaser that feels like a special occasion dish but comes together with ease. Whether you’re feeding family, impressing brunch guests, or just treating yourself, this quiche is sure to bring smiles and happy bellies. So go ahead, grab those fresh ingredients and make this gem of a recipe your own—it’s time to savor every delicious bite.
Print
Easy Tomato Spinach Feta Quiche Recipe
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Total Time: 1 hour
- Yield: 8 servings
- Category: Breakfast, Brunch, Lunch
- Method: Baking
- Cuisine: Mediterranean
- Diet: Vegetarian
Description
This Easy Tomato Spinach Feta Quiche is a delightful savory pie featuring a flaky puff pastry crust filled with a rich blend of eggs, cream, fresh spinach, tangy feta cheese, and juicy cherry tomatoes. Perfect for brunch, lunch, or a light dinner, this quiche offers a balanced combination of creamy, fresh, and slightly tangy flavors, elegantly baked to golden perfection.
Ingredients
Pastry
- 8.5 oz puff pastry (rolled out to fit into your pie dish and over the rim)
Filling
- 5 large eggs
- 2/3 cup heavy cream
- 1/2 cup milk
- 2 cups baby spinach (chopped if larger)
- 1/4 cup grated parmesan
- 1 teaspoon dried oregano
- 1/2 teaspoon salt
- Black pepper (to taste)
- 6 oz Feta cheese (coarsely crumbled)
Topping
- 1/2 pound cherry tomatoes
- 1 teaspoon olive oil
Instructions
- Blind Bake the Puff Pastry: Preheat your oven to 400°F (200°C). Lightly grease a 9-inch (23 cm) deep-dish pie plate, then press the rolled-out puff pastry into the dish, letting it hang over the edges. Use a fork to prick the bottom of the pastry multiple times to prevent bubbling during baking.
- Prepare for Blind Baking: Place a piece of baking parchment paper over the pastry and fill it with pie weights or dried beans to keep the crust from puffing up excessively. Bake for 15 minutes, then remove the weights and parchment, continuing to bake for an additional 10 minutes until the crust is lightly golden. Allow it to cool slightly.
- Make the Filling: While the crust bakes, whisk together the eggs, heavy cream, and milk in a large bowl until smooth. Stir in the chopped baby spinach, grated parmesan, dried oregano, salt, and black pepper until well combined.
- Assemble the Quiche: Reduce the oven temperature to 360°F (180°C). Scatter the crumbled feta cheese evenly over the bottom of the pre-baked pastry shell. Pour the egg and spinach mixture over the feta. Toss the cherry tomatoes with olive oil to coat, then arrange them on top of the filling.
- Bake the Quiche: Bake the quiche uncovered for 20 minutes. To protect the pastry edges from burning, cover the rim with a pie shield or aluminum foil. Continue baking for another 30 to 35 minutes, or until the filling is set and no longer jiggly in the center.
- Rest and Serve: Remove the quiche from the oven and allow it to rest for about 10 minutes before slicing. For best flavor, you may also cool it completely, cover, and chill for up to 24 hours before serving.
Notes
- You can substitute the baby spinach with fresh kale or Swiss chard if preferred, but be sure to chop it finely and sauté briefly if using tougher greens.
- Using a pie shield or foil prevents the puff pastry edges from burning while the quiche finishes baking.
- For a lighter version, substitute half-and-half for heavy cream or use all milk instead.
- This quiche can be served warm, at room temperature, or cold from the refrigerator.
- Leftovers should be stored covered in the fridge and consumed within 24-48 hours for best quality.

